Features
- 169fs RMS phase jitter (12kHz to 20MHz, 156.25MHz)
- PCIe® Gen6 Common Clock (CC) 27fs RMS
- PCIe SRIS and SRNS support
- 1kHz to 650MHz (differential) and 1kHz to 200MHz (single-ended) outputs
- LVCMOS, LVDS, or Low-Power HCSL output types with simple AC coupling to LVPECL and CML. LP-HCSL integrates terminations
- Seven programmable general purpose input/outputs (GPIO)
- 1MHz I2C serial port
- Multiple configurations can be stored in internal one-time programmable (OTP) memory
- 1.8V and/or 3.3V operation
- IATF 16949 manufacturing support
- Package options:
- 12 differential or 24 single-ended outputs
- 6mm x 6mm x 0.75mm, 48-QFN package
- RC21211: Single crystal
- RC21212: Dual crystal
- 8 differential or 16 single-ended outputs
- 5mm x 5mm x 0.75mm, 40-QFN package
- RC21213: Single crystal
- RC21214: Dual crystal
- 12 differential or 24 single-ended outputs
Description
The RC2121 family of devices are high-performance programmable clock generators with added diagnostic features to support automotive applications. These RC2121 clock generators are ISO 9001 compliant, AEC-Q100 qualified, can function in the temperature range of -40 °C to 105 °C (Grade 2 equivalent), and provide support for the production part approval process (PPAP).

- Application NotePDF 280 KB R31AN0071EU0101 Rev.1.01 Aug 16, 2024AI-generated Summary: The document details the design considerations for transitioning PCB layouts from RC210xxA VersaClock devices to RC2121xA AutoClock devices. It compares pinouts for 48-pin and 40-pin variants, highlighting common and renamed pins. It covers I2C implementation differences, backup crystal usage, GPIO functionalities including new INT and FAULT pins, and 3.3V tolerance specifics. The document also explains interrupt and fault pin schematics and 1.2V LVCMOS clock input requirements. It supports up to four OTP images on AutoClock devices and clarifies pull-up resistor configurations for open-drain pins. PCB design files typically include BOM, schematics, and Gerber files to facilitate this transition.
- Application NotePDF 359 KB R31AN0072EU0100 Rev.1.00 May 08, 2024AI-generated Summary: The RC2121xA devices provide comprehensive monitoring and diagnostic features to support system safety by detecting errors, notifying the SoC via interrupts, and entering a safe inactive state when faults occur. They supply various clocks to SoC and peripherals, with monitoring functions including pulse width detection, signal loss, frequency monitoring, and CRC checks. System integrators must ensure proper voltage monitoring, I2C CRC, interrupt testing, and clock synchronization. The devices aid diagnostics through detailed fault reporting and support end-to-end protection for high-speed serial interfaces.

12-Output AutoClock Programmable Clock Generator Evaluation Board
The RC21212-EVB evaluation board is designed for evaluating the RC21212 using clock generation in synthesizer mode for commercial automotive applications and PCIe Gen 1-6 compliance.
